Ajith Kumar to Join Asian Le Mans Series Grid with Team Virage

Tamil Cinema star will race in LMP3 with Narain Karthikeyan

Tamil Cinema star Ajith Kumar will take part in the 2025/26 Asian Le Mans Series with 2023 Michelin Le Mans Cup LMP3 team champions Team Virage. 
 
The multi award winning actor, who will be making his Le Mans Prototype debut in the opening round in Malaysia after competing in single seaters and GTs, will join forces with fellow Indian, and former F1 racer, Narain Karthikeyan in the no1 Ligier JS P325-Toyota in the LMP3 class.
 
Ajith Kumar said, “I’m looking forward to an exciting season in the Asian Le Mans Series, consider it an honour and a privilege to be a part is this series and here is wishing Automobile Club de l’Ouest (ACO), SRO Motorsports Group and everyone involved all the very best!  I’m looking forward to being part of this prestigious series all that the LMP3 has to offer.”
Team Virage will be running two cars in the LMP3 category in their Asian Le Mans Series debut season, with the no8 Ligier-Toyota being raced by Swiss drivers Yohann Segala and Danny Buntschu.
 
Julien Gerbi, 2023 MLMC Drivers’ Champion and Team Virage CEO, said: “It's very exciting to have Ajith and Narain in the car. We will have a third driver, who is yet to be decided. 
 
“It's definitely something that we are looking forward to a lot. First of all, to compete in the Asian Le Mans under the name of Team Virage for the first time, to go with two cars and to go with this impressive lineup.
 
“We expect a lot of Indian fans to follow us this season but not only in India. He's very famous worldwide, even my barber in a small village in Spain actually knows him. We are looking forward seeing a lot of his fans in Sepang this December.”
 
“It's nice to finally be able to come to the Asian Le Mans Series as we have always wanted to do it. The fact that the championship keeps on growing and getting stronger and more attractive every year is even better for us.”
 
The 2025/26 Asian Le Mans Series will be held over six races in Malaysia, Dubai and Abu Dhabi, beginning with the 4 Hours of Sepang on the 12-14 December 2025.
